Gondmohadi

Gondmohadi is a village located in Chimur tehsil of Chandrapur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Chimur (tehsildar office) and 117km away from district headquarter Chandrapur. As per 2009 stats, Vihirgaon Tukum is the gram panchayat of Gondmohadi village.

About Gondmohadi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gondmohadi is 540537. The village spans a total geographical area of 628.96 hectares. Warora is nearest town to Gondmohadi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 83km away.

Population of Gondmohadi

According to the 2011 Census, Gondmohadi has a total population of about 274, with approximately 145 males and 129 females. The sex ratio is around 889 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 34 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 41 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 150. The overall literacy rate is approximately 68.98%, with male literacy at about 75.17% and female literacy near 62.02%. There are around 71 households in the village. 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 274 145 129
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 34 20 14
Scheduled Castes (SC) 41 17 24
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 150 83 67
Literate Population 189 109 80
Illiterate Population 85 36 49

Connectivity of Gondmohadi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gondmohadi. As per the 2011 stats, Gondmohadi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
